Ingredients
2 servings

0.75 poundsugar snap peas
0.5 poundfresh red radishes

2 tablespoonsbutter

½ teaspoonsalt

¼ teaspoonsugar
Instructions
Step 1
Trim the tips from the sugar snap peas and remove the fibrous string that runs along the top of the pod. Trim the radishes and cut into 1/8-inch thick slices
Step 2
Heat the butter in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add the snap peas and sauté for about 1 minute. Add the radishes and continue cooking until they begin to turn translucent, about 1 to 1 1/2 minutes. Sprinkle with salt and sugar, toss to combine and serve.
